This is the exciting world of children’s ministry at The Point! We believe that kids are not the church of tomorrow; they are the church of today and are a vital part of our vision and ministry here at The Point.

We are committed to investing time, resources and energy into the lives of children and their families. Our goal is to partner with parents to ensure that each child grows in their walk with God and in their understanding and application of the Gospel of Jesus Christ as they encounter Truth, Worship Jesus, learn to live in biblical Community and live on Mission each day.  Our desire is that each child will ultimately come to know Jesus and grow in that personal relationship.

Our dedicated team of teachers and volunteers serve unselfishly to model and teach the love of our Savior.  All children’s ministry workers at The Point have been screened, interviewed, trained, and tested and the environment in which children are taught and cared for during each worship service or midweek program is loving, fun, engaging, safe, competent and clean.  We absolutely LOVE kids at The Point!

While we value family worship, we offer Kidstyle Worship as an option during each of our Sunday morning gatherings.  This is a fun and engaging opportunity for children K-3rd grade to worship “Kidstyle” in a safe, loving, engaging environment while parents participate in corporate worship.  Children are dismissed to join their families to participate together in the larger setting following the message.

In a nutshell, we seek to offer life-changing children’s ministry where Jesus is magnified and God’s Word is creatively taught and expressed, where its unchanging truths are presented in ways that engage a child’s heart and mind, where shepherding children and equipping parents is intentional, where kids are safe to be who they are and ask questions, and where discovering God’s truth is exciting and fun!

Curriculum

We believe that children can handle deep truth even at a young age. Their minds are like sponges and they memorize things almost effortlessly. So, our curriculum is intended to cultivate a strong knowledge of God and to immerse kids in the Bible at a very early age.

Many children’s ministry curriculum uses Bible stories to teach moral lessons and values. This approach misses the point by making the Bible out to be a moral guide instead of a book about Jesus! Our curriculum is designed to make the character of God and the person and work of Jesus central in every story and lesson. In all classrooms we sing, pray, tell Bible stories, ask questions, and work on craft projects all according to age groups.
